This procedure displays, edits, and deletes existing document alerts, and adds new document alerts on a currently selected document.
Note: This feature is only available in KnowledgeTree Commercial (on-premise, or KnowledgeTreeLive).
Note: Adding an alert allows the system to notify the creator of the alert, other users that may be included in the alert, when action is due on the document. Users included in the alert receive an email and a dashboard notification when the alert is triggered.
Note: Document Type Alerts Document Type Alerts is a feature in KnowledgeTree that allows the system administrator to create an alert on a document based on its document type - the alert is automatically applied to all documents of the specified document type. Users view document type alerts listed as an existing 'system' alert for the document. When the system alert (document type alert) is triggered, affected users receive an email advising them of the action to take for the document type alert, and a message for the alert displays on the Dashboard.
